**Secure Interview Room — night shift notes**

Quick one for the overnight crew at Hollyvale House: Room 1.12 is now the secure room for candidate interviews and confidential calls. If you're doing rounds, don't prop the door or let anyone tailgate in — it stays locked even when empty. Recruiting sometimes runs late sessions, so check the booking sheet first. To get in for checks, use the door code below.

staff pass of kajef-yafog = bdg-A-89

A heads-up on the ledger store: currency conversions in Coinlark used to round at each step, so a three-hop conversion could drift by a cent or two. We now keep amounts in micro-units and round once at display time. The old drifted rows are flagged in fx_adjustments for audit. That table sits in the finance replica, reachable via the connection string below.

primary connection of tajeg-tajop = postgresql://julax_svc:DI@db-e7f3.kelvidyn.corp:5432/rusdor

Subject: Scheduled key rotation for Parcelgrove webhook

Plugin authors: the credential used by the Parcelgrove parcel-tracking webhook to call the internal Waybill Relay service will rotate on the first of next month. Deliveries signed with the old key will be rejected after that date. Update your plugin configuration ahead of time. The replacement key is provided below.

gateway credential: kto23_LX9A4ys6i4nzHtpOLNLodKK

## Break-Glass Access — Quillbox Autocomplete

The Quillbox autocomplete index on cluster nadir-3 is degrading; p99 latency exceeds 900ms. If the admin console is unreachable during rebuild, use break-glass to reach the index controller directly. Reviewers: confirm the rebuild diff touches only the trigram shards. Break-glass sessions are logged and expire in 30 minutes. The recovery passphrase follows below.

vault phrase of tajeg-tageg = pelix-druix-holius-briael-zorwyn-frawyn-fraox-norok-drueth-aldiel